Main Causes of Stake auth token expired issue

The core reason behind this glitch is often a security trigger. Stake utilizes strict anti-bot protection (like Cloudflare). If your IP address or browser fingerprint looks suspicious, or if the casino’s node is undergoing temporary maintenance, you will get this error.

Step-by-Step Troubleshooting Guide:

  1. Clear Cache and Cookies: Go to your browser configurations, wipe the local history for the last 24 hours, and restart your application. This flushes broken Stake sessions.
  2. Modify Your Proxy/VPN Protocol: Switch from standard OpenVPN to WireGuard protocol inside your application, or connect to an entirely different country node that allows access to Stake.
  3. Disable Browser Extensions: Launch a private tab or temporarily disable active extensions like uBlock or Ghostery, which frequently trigger false-positive errors on crypto casinos.
  4. Reboot Network Connection: Switch from Wi-Fi to a mobile hotspot (or vice versa). This completely alters your external IP address and establishes a fresh routing path to Stake.
